Transportation RF Engineering

How are environmental and EMC tests tailored for rail, maritime, road and airborne RF hardware?

Derive test category, severity, axes, harness, operating modes and pass criteria from the exact installation rather than treating a platform standard as a universal certificate.

Environmental and EMC tailoring starts with the exact platform, mounting zone and lifecycle. Separate storage, shipment, installation, operation, cleaning and maintenance; then define temperature, humidity and condensation, water, salt, dust, fluids, pressure or altitude, shock, vibration, mounting stiffness, cable mass and thermal boundary. The applicable category for a protected cabin, exterior roof, engine space, wayside cabinet, vessel mast or airborne bay can differ even when the equipment function is similar.

For EMC, identify equipment boundary, ports, cable lengths and terminations, enclosure, bonds, power source, loads, software and radio states. Define emissions and immunity methods, frequency and severity, dwell, modulation, monitoring, degradation and recovery criteria. Add a simultaneous-radio matrix for antenna-port blocking, harmonics, intermodulation and recovery. A method number without configuration and pass criteria is not transferable compliance evidence.

Use a requirement-verification matrix to record applicability, revision, category, tailored deviation, article, axes, setup, operating state, monitoring and raw evidence. Repeat calibrated RF measurements before and after exposure and during exposure when performance must be maintained. Product or platform approval remains the responsibility of the defined conformity route; a supplier component test must not be promoted as rolling-stock, vehicle, maritime or airworthiness approval.
